Jordanian SMEs strengthen their capacity in water management through the SPEEDUP project
The International Center for Water, Environment and Energy Research at Al-Balqa Applied University conducted a specialized workshop titled “Rainwater Harvesting and Greywater Systems”, held on 23 December 2025 in Irbid, Jordan with the participation of 50 attendees from small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) and organizations related to the water and environmental sectors.
